The solution implemented by Q2BSTUDIO relies on a custom software approach that adapts to existing workflows, avoiding the rigidity of generic platforms. The AI assistant, trained on corporate documentation and company databases, responds to queries in natural language, locates experts within the directory, and suggests automated actions. To ensure security and regulatory compliance, advanced cybersecurity techniques are employed, such as end-to-end encryption and role-based access controls, deployed on AWS and Azure cloud services.
Furthermore, the platform integrates with business intelligence tools like Power BI, generating real-time dashboards that measure productivity, assistant adoption, and process bottlenecks. Q2BSTUDIO also developed specialized AI agents that orchestrate tasks such as request approvals or master data updates, all without constant human intervention. This combination of AI for businesses and custom development has allowed the client company in Las Palmas to accelerate its operational cycles and free its team from low-value administrative tasks.
The project was executed using an agile methodology, with discovery phases, a functional prototype in weeks, and progressive deployment. The key to success lay in first mapping critical processes and data sources, and then building the intranet and assistant as a unified layer over legacy systems.
